Texas Republican Bo French Faces Backlash Over Post Targeting South Asian Students

Analysed 14 Sept 2026·7 sources analysed·Texas, United States·Politics
Texas Republican Bo French Faces Backlash Over Post Targeting South Asian StudentsPreviousNext

Bo French, the Republican nominee for Texas Railroad Commissioner, faced widespread criticism after posting on social media a photo of South Asian and Indian-American students celebrating a University of Texas football win, labeling them as 'foreigners' and suggesting Americans were being displaced. The post was condemned by Republican leaders including Senator John Cornyn and Texas Governor Greg Abbott, as well as Democrats and Indian American advocacy groups, who called the remarks racist and xenophobic. French's comments sparked calls for him to remove the post amid broader debates on immigration and diversity in Texas universities.
